#include <string>
#include <vector>
#include "base/command_line.h"
#include "base/memory/scoped_ptr.h"
#include "base/memory/scoped_vector.h"
#include "chrome/browser/chrome_browser_main.h"
#include "chrome/browser/chrome_content_browser_client.h"
#include "chrome/common/chrome_switches.h"
#include "chrome/test/base/testing_pref_service.h"
#include "content/public/browser/content_browser_client.h"
#include "content/public/common/main_function_params.h"
#include "net/socket/client_socket_pool_base.h"
#include "testing/gtest/include/gtest/gtest.h"
class BrowserMainTest : public testing::Test {
public:
BrowserMainTest()
: command_line_(CommandLine::NO_PROGRAM) {
ChromeBrowserMainParts::disable_enforcing_cookie_policies_for_tests_ = true;
}
protected:
TestingPrefService pref_service_;
CommandLine command_line_;
};
TEST_F(BrowserMainTest, WarmConnectionFieldTrial_WarmestSocket) {
command_line_.AppendSwitchASCII(switches::kSocketReusePolicy, "0");
scoped_ptr<content::MainFunctionParams> params(
new content::MainFunctionParams(command_line_));
scoped_ptr<content::BrowserMainParts> browser_main_parts(
content::GetContentClient()->browser()->CreateBrowserMainParts(*params));
ChromeBrowserMainParts* chrome_main_parts =
static_cast<ChromeBrowserMainParts*>(browser_main_parts.get());
EXPECT_TRUE(chrome_main_parts);
if (chrome_main_parts) {
base::FieldTrialList field_trial_list_(NULL);
chrome_main_parts->browser_field_trials_.WarmConnectionFieldTrial();
EXPECT_EQ(0, net::GetSocketReusePolicy());
}
}
TEST_F(BrowserMainTest, WarmConnectionFieldTrial_Random) {
scoped_ptr<content::MainFunctionParams> params(
new content::MainFunctionParams(command_line_));
scoped_ptr<content::BrowserMainParts> browser_main_parts(
content::GetContentClient()->browser()->CreateBrowserMainParts(*params));
ChromeBrowserMainParts* chrome_main_parts =
static_cast<ChromeBrowserMainParts*>(browser_main_parts.get());
EXPECT_TRUE(chrome_main_parts);
if (chrome_main_parts) {
const int kNumRuns = 1000;
for (int i = 0; i < kNumRuns; i++) {
base::FieldTrialList field_trial_list_(NULL);
chrome_main_parts->browser_field_trials_.WarmConnectionFieldTrial();
int val = net::GetSocketReusePolicy();
EXPECT_LE(val, 2);
EXPECT_GE(val, 0);
}
}
}
